在exceljs中为Angular添加表格,可以通过以下步骤完成:
- 首先,确保已经安装了exceljs库。可以使用以下命令进行安装:
- 首先,确保已经安装了exceljs库。可以使用以下命令进行安装:
- 在Angular项目中,创建一个新的服务(例如ExcelService),用于处理Excel文件的生成和导出。可以使用以下命令创建服务:
- 在Angular项目中,创建一个新的服务(例如ExcelService),用于处理Excel文件的生成和导出。可以使用以下命令创建服务:
- 在ExcelService中,导入exceljs库:
- 在ExcelService中,导入exceljs库:
- 创建一个新的方法,用于生成Excel文件并添加表格。以下是一个示例方法:
- 创建一个新的方法,用于生成Excel文件并添加表格。以下是一个示例方法:
- 在需要使用Excel导出功能的组件中,注入ExcelService,并调用生成Excel文件的方法。以下是一个示例组件:
- 在需要使用Excel导出功能的组件中,注入ExcelService,并调用生成Excel文件的方法。以下是一个示例组件:
通过以上步骤,就可以在Angular中使用exceljs库为Excel添加表格。在ExcelService中的generateExcelWithTable
方法中,可以根据需要自定义表头、数据行的内容和样式。最后,通过调用workbook.xlsx.writeBuffer()
方法生成Excel文件的二进制数据,并通过创建下载链接的方式实现文件的导出。
请注意,以上示例中的代码仅供参考,具体实现可能需要根据项目的需求进行调整。